请教大佬这个图怎么画??用matplotlib
http://p2.so.qhmsg.com/t0276cc1d4e067e5afa.jpg整体的框架我会,就是这个图我画不出来,求大佬指点!
我的程序:import numpy as np
import matplotlib.pyplot as plt
import matplotlib
import random
matplotlib.rcParams['font.family']='SimHei'
matplotlib.rcParams['font.sans-serif'] = ['SimHei']
matplotlib.rcParams['axes.unicode_minus'] = False
plt.figure()
plt.title('第五个图')
plt.xlabel('x轴')
plt.ylabel('y轴')
plt.xlim(0,400)
plt.ylim(2,14)
x = range(0,300)
y = []
a = 2
b = 3
c = 50
for i in x:
if i < c:
y.append(random.uniform(a,b,))
a += 0.01
b += 0.01
else:
y.append(random.uniform(a,b,))
a -= 0.01
b -= 0.01
while i % c == 0:
c += 50
a += 1.5
b += 1.5
plt.plot(x,y)
plt.show()
召唤大佬{:10_256:}@Twilight6 zltzlt 发表于 2020-8-1 19:29
召唤大佬@Twilight6
谢谢版主{:5_92:} 召唤下一位大佬:@永恒的蓝色梦想 陈尚涵 发表于 2020-8-1 19:32
召唤下一位大佬:@永恒的蓝色梦想
谢谢前一位大佬! 5466a 发表于 2020-8-1 19:33
谢谢前一位大佬!
我不是大佬{:10_297:} 陈尚涵 发表于 2020-8-1 19:32
召唤下一位大佬:@永恒的蓝色梦想
不会 Matplotlib {:10_245:} 永恒的蓝色梦想 发表于 2020-8-1 19:35
不会 Matplotlib
我也不太懂{:10_266:} 陈尚涵 发表于 2020-8-1 19:34
我不是大佬
在我心中你就是{:5_109:} 永恒的蓝色梦想 发表于 2020-8-1 19:35
不会 Matplotlib
太难了,实在是憋不出来了 陈尚涵 发表于 2020-8-1 19:35
我也不太懂
{:10_266:}大佬慢走 5466a 发表于 2020-8-1 19:38
太难了,实在是憋不出来了
Matplotlib我只会一点基础{:10_266:},你试试用PyQt? 本帖最后由 陈尚涵 于 2020-8-1 19:47 编辑
5466a 发表于 2020-8-1 19:39
大佬慢走
额,我也无能为力了 本帖最后由 陈尚涵 于 2020-8-1 19:47 编辑
你可以在这个人的空间里学PyQt:
https://space.bilibili.com/371514629?spm_id_from=333.788.b_765f7570696e666f.1 陈尚涵 发表于 2020-8-1 19:42
我觉得PyQt比Matplotlib要简单。你这是作业还是什么?如果是小练习的话,我建议你还是用PyQt吧。
你憨?拿 GUI 和 绘图库 作比较? 陈尚涵 发表于 2020-8-1 19:42
我觉得PyQt比Matplotlib要简单。你这是作业还是什么?如果是小练习的话,我建议你还是用PyQt吧。
小练习,但是是让我用所学的知识。。。。。只学过这个 永恒的蓝色梦想 发表于 2020-8-1 19:44
你憨?拿 GUI 和 绘图库 作比较?
额,不好意思,说漏嘴了,我这就改回来{:10_250:} 陈尚涵 发表于 2020-8-1 19:42
我觉得PyQt比Matplotlib要简单。你这是作业还是什么?如果是小练习的话,我建议你还是用PyQt吧。
净扯 陈尚涵 发表于 2020-8-1 19:43
你可以在这个人的空间里学PyQt,如果帮到你了,请设置最佳答案哦~
https://space.bilibili.com/371514629? ...
嗯嗯 好的 陈尚涵 发表于 2020-8-1 19:42
我觉得PyQt比Matplotlib要简单。你这是作业还是什么?如果是小练习的话,我建议你还是用PyQt吧。
秀一段 Qt5 我们看看
页:
[1]
2